Multimodal Prehabilitation in Cancer Surgery

Multimodal Prehabilitation in Cancer Surgery PROPOSE Trial (PRehabilitation in Oncological Patients undergOing SurgEry): A Randomized Trial

Summary

The PROPOSE RCT is a two-arm randomized controlled trial that will be conducted to test the efficacy of a personalized, multidisciplinary pre-operative prehabilitation program (preventive prehabilitation) to reduce serious complications and facilitate recovery after surgery in high-risk patients. The multimodal prehabilitation program is a preoperative intervention that includes exercise training, nutritional therapy and anxiety reduction techniques, with the aim of preventing or mitigating the functional decline brought about by surgery. 400 patients scheduled for elective major abdominal (including urological), thoracic (including breast) or gynecological cancer surgery will be enrolled. They will be randomized (1:1 ratio) and assigned either to the intervention group (Prehabilitation) or to the control group, which will only be treated according to the usual standard of care within the Enhanced Recovery After Surgery (ERAS) pathways.

Interventions

BEHAVIORALMultimodal prehabilitation Program

A tailored intervention will be prescribed if specific physical, nutritional or psychological impairments will be identified during the assessment phase. Based on the data obtained during the multimodal assessment, different domains and levels of care will be prescribed, focusing on exercise training, and/or nutrition optimization, and/or distress-coping techniques. Different combinations of three domains will be utilized to maximize their synergistic anabolic effects. The duration of the program will be set at a minimum of three weeks.
